Voiding Dysfunction

Voiding Dysfunction can involve one or more conditions where there is poor coordination between the bladder muscle and the urethra.

Erectile Dysfunction

Erectile Dysfunction (ED) is the inability for men to achieve or maintain a penile erection. ED does not affect the ability to have an orgasm but may inhibit the ability to have sexual intercourse.

Benign Prostate Hyperplasia

Benign Prostate Hyperplasia (BPH) is also referred to as enlarged prostate—a small, walnut-shaped organ located just below the bladder that is part of the male reproductive system.

Urinary Obstruction

Urinary Obstruction is any alteration of the flow of urine as it travels from the kidneys through the urethra.
